var createSecretReceiverCmd = &cobra.Command{
Use: "receiver [name]",
Short: "Create or update a Kubernetes secret for a Receiver webhook",
Long: `The create secret receiver command generates a Kubernetes secret with
the token used for webhook payload validation and an annotation with the
computed webhook URL.`,
Example: ` # Create a receiver secret for a GitHub webhook
flux create secret receiver github-receiver \
--namespace=my-namespace \
--type=github \
--hostname=flux.example.com \
--export
# Create a receiver secret for GCR with email claim
flux create secret receiver gcr-receiver \
--namespace=my-namespace \
--type=gcr \
--hostname=flux.example.com \
--email-claim=sa@project.iam.gserviceaccount.com \
--export`,
RunE: createSecretReceiverCmdRun,
}
type secretReceiverFlags struct {
receiverType flags.ReceiverType
token string
hostname string
emailClaim string
}
var secretReceiverArgs secretReceiverFlags
func init() {
createSecretReceiverCmd.Flags().Var(&secretReceiverArgs.receiverType, "type", secretReceiverArgs.receiverType.Description())
createSecretReceiverCmd.Flags().StringVar(&secretReceiverArgs.token, "token", "", "webhook token used for payload validation and URL computation, auto-generated if not specified")
createSecretReceiverCmd.Flags().StringVar(&secretReceiverArgs.hostname, "hostname", "", "hostname for the webhook URL e.g. flux.example.com")
createSecretReceiverCmd.Flags().StringVar(&secretReceiverArgs.emailClaim, "email-claim", "", "IAM service account email, required for gcr type")
createSecretCmd.AddCommand(createSecretReceiverCmd)
}

func GenerateReceiver(options Options) (*manifestgen.Manifest, error) {
token := options.Token
if token == "" {
b := make([]byte, 32)
if _, err := rand.Read(b); err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to generate random token: %w", err)
}
token = hex.EncodeToString(b)
}
if options.Hostname == "" {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("hostname is required")
}
// Compute the webhook path using the same algorithm as notification-controller.
// See: github.com/fluxcd/notification-controller/api/v1.Receiver.GetWebhookPath
digest := sha256.Sum256([]byte(token + options.Name + options.Namespace))
webhookPath := fmt.Sprintf("/hook/%x", digest)
webhookURL := fmt.Sprintf("https://%s%s", options.Hostname, webhookPath)
secret := &corev1.Secret{
TypeMeta: metav1.TypeMeta{
APIVersion: "v1",
Kind: "Secret",
},
ObjectMeta: metav1.ObjectMeta{
Name: options.Name,
Namespace: options.Namespace,
Labels: options.Labels,
Annotations: map[string]string{
WebhookURLAnnotation: webhookURL,
},
},
StringData: map[string]string{
TokenSecretKey: token,
},
}
if options.ReceiverType == "gcr" {
if options.EmailClaim == "" {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("email-claim is required for gcr receiver type")
}
secret.StringData[EmailSecretKey] = options.EmailClaim
secret.StringData[AudienceSecretKey] = webhookURL
}
return secretToManifest(secret, options)
}
